Transaction 3815a3a85041e86843dc154c48211310cccaf9184a7392e70543b2640d21b5ed
2 Input
2 Outputs
- 3815a3a85041e86843dc154c48211310cccaf9184a7392e70543b2640d21b5ed:0
- 3815a3a85041e86843dc154c48211310cccaf9184a7392e70543b2640d21b5ed:1
value 461029
address 1AHPEKNPw23ts3KpxMXUWDnnxnSrF4ZtJ8
value 79317
address 1NmPGfwf1NxQT7e8d7WYDpXYBYb1Q36ewH